What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.133(a)(1):  Protective eye and/or face equipment was not required where there was a reasonable probability of injury that could be prevented by such equipment:     a.) Armac Resources, LLC, Rig platform(well site-M4), on or about November 15, 2012, and times prior thereto:  Company employees who were potentially exposed to eye and face hazards from flying particles while conducting or working around metal to metal hammering tasks during fracking/rigging operations were not wearing safety glasses or other forms of eye / face protection.

29 CFR 1910.132(f)(1): The employer did not provide training to each employee who is required by this section to use personal protective equipment:      a.)Armac Resources, LLC, Rig platform (well site-M4), on or about November 15, 2012, and times prior thereto:  Company employees had not been provided with training on the required personal protective equipment needed when working in and around fracking operations as evidenced by the fact that company employees were not utilizing safety glasses or other forms of eye/face protection during fracking operations.
